Output 12e685ffc074b5b1d90ac4e7b924da69a32ffe44af95e46d6e43b45b05af19cf:1

value
62656310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 261f0ab69332f816ac065693495988734206fd1c OP_EQUAL
address
35AanfAGzPmiy5UbuLAvq1SAnK4ACrY7Mh
transaction
12e685ffc074b5b1d90ac4e7b924da69a32ffe44af95e46d6e43b45b05af19cf
confirmations
299571
spent
true